If your plugin sees duplicated or reverted events after a sync cycle, check that you're honoring the revision token returned by the write API — replaying stale tokens is the most common cause. Include the conflict log excerpt and your plugin version in any report; reports without logs are deprioritized. Consult the conflict-resolution guide in the docs folder first. For unresolved conflict issues, contact the integrations team at the address below.

alerts address for kajog-tadup: druox@plorvanet.internal

## Escalation: Replica Lag Alarm (Quillbase)

If the `quillbase-replica-lag` alarm fires for more than ten minutes, first confirm the primary is healthy and check whether a long-running analytics query is holding replication back. Kill any offending query only after noting its origin in the incident log. If lag exceeds thirty minutes or the replica stops applying WAL entirely, escalate to the Datastore Reliability rotation rather than attempting a manual resync yourself. Reach the rotation lead directly at the address below.

pager mailbox: druwyn@norvaio.corp

The Sweepstone service scans the Farrowgate cloud accounts nightly and deletes orphaned volumes and stale snapshots. As on-call, you may need to run it manually after a failed teardown. Copy the provided .env template and confirm the dry-run flag is set, then append the sweeper's API secret on the next line.

sealed setting: RELAY_SECRET5=82864